A HOTEL in Alresford has received recognition for its breakfasts.
The Swan, which now houses the new town clock, has been given Kellogg’s Breakfast Award after a VisitEngland representative assessed the hotel.
The inspector praised the quality of the food and the staff’s service describing the full English as a “very generous portion size, quality bacon was crispy, a very "meaty" local pork sausage, scrambled egg was creamy and beautifully cooked, the mushrooms being well seasoned. All served on a preheated plate, adding to the guests’ enjoyment.”
General manager Andy Ayres said: “We’re all very pleased to have been given this award. We have all worked really hard since our refurbishment last year and we’ve got a really tight team here with friendly staff. Being family owned gives us the great benefit of offering a personal service.
“This is the third award we’ve received over the last few years and we’ve gone from a two-star rating to a three-star rating this year. We’re hoping for a fourth star in the near future.”
The hotel was presented with a Hampshire Hospitality Award earlier this year and was the inaugural winner of the Alresford Chamber of Commerce Business Award 2013.
